Eleanora Alathea Walmesley
Birth date:
1660
Birth place:
Lytham, Lancashire, , England
 
Death date:
 
Death place:
  , , ,

Walmesley Family

Parents:
Father: Richard Walmesley
Mother: Mary Fromond
Spouse:
Spouse: Thomas Clifton
 
Siblings:
Eleanora Alathea Walmesley
Children:
Elizabeth Clifton
Elizabeth Clifton